Asymmetry of coercivity dependence on temperature in exchange-biased FeMn/Co bilayers

中文摘要The temperature dependence of the coercivity in biased FeMn/Co bilayers is investigated. An asymmetric behavior of the left and right coercivity with varying temperature is observed. The asymmetry can be understood by taking into account the variation of the spin arrangements in the antiferromagnetic layer. The calculated results are in agreement with the experimental ones qualitatively. All these results suggest that the magnetization reversal mechanisms are different for increasing and decreasing fields. (C) 2000 American Institute of Physics. [S0003-6951(00)01743-5].
